selftests/net: fix waiting time for ipv6_gc test in fib_tests.sh.



ipv6_gc fails occasionally. According to the study, fib6_run_gc() using
jiffies_round() to round the GC interval could increase the waiting time up
to 750ms (3/4 seconds). The timer has a granularity of 512ms at the range
4s to 32s. That means a route with an expiration time E seconds can wait
for more than E * 2 + 1 seconds if the GC interval is also E seconds.

E * 2 + 2 seconds should be enough for waiting for removing routes.

Also remove a check immediately after replacing 5 routes since it is very
likely to remove some of routes before completing the last route with a
slow environment.
